ABOUT VIZ.AI Viz.ai is the leader in building and deploying AI-powered Care Pathways and helping doctors do their work. The Viz Platform is deployed in 2,000 hospitals across the United States and trusted by many of the leading life sciences companies. The platform uniquely combines real-time, multimodal clinical data with deep clinician engagement to detect disease earlier, coordinate care teams, and help ensure patients receive the right treatment faster. Viz.ai was the first company to be awarded CMS reimbursement for AI and is ranked the #1 Healthcare AI Platform by hospitals and health systems in the Black Book Research survey. How to Stand Out
- Highlight concrete examples of how you’ve coached GTM or sales managers and the measurable outcomes achieved.
- Showcase any experience automating HR processes with AI or data‑analysis tools; include specific tools or scripts you built.
- Prepare to discuss how you’d diagnose a remote team’s engagement risk using people data.
- Bring a brief case study that demonstrates your ability to design a manager‑development program from scratch.
- Research Viz.ai’s AI platform and be ready to explain why its mission resonates with you during the interview.
- When negotiating, consider equity and remote‑work allowances alongside base salary, given the company’s growth stage.
- Watch for vague promises about “playbooks”; ask how much autonomy the role truly has to shape people strategy.
